Positive Themes About Bose
-
Innovation-Driven Growth: A steady cadence of new ANC headphones/earbuds and a re-entry into home speakers across 2025–2026 highlights active investment in core categories. This pattern points to sustained innovation momentum.
-
Strategic Partnerships: Acquisitions such as StreamUnlimited Engineering and McIntosh Group, alongside a visible “Sound by Bose” licensing push, indicate a deliberate expansion of platform capabilities and partner reach. These moves position the business to scale beyond Bose‑branded hardware.
-
Strong Brand Reputation: Feedback suggests the brand remains highly considered in the U.S. and is repeatedly positioned at or near the top for premium ANC performance. This reputation supports demand resilience for flagship offerings.
